Key Functions Protection Features Over-voltage Protection: Cuts off power if voltage exceeds the set threshold (P-3). Under-voltage Protection: Disconnects load if voltage drops below the set limit (P-5). Over-current Protection: Trips when current surpasses the configured max (P-9) after a delay (P-10). Automatic Recovery: Restores power after fault conditions (adjustable via P-15). Fast Power-Down: Emergency cutoff (enabled via P-14). Monitoring & Display Real-time voltage display (AC/DC). Real-time current display (AC only; DC mode shows voltage only). Indicators for faults (>V, <V, >A) and normal operation (POWER). Programmable Settings Adjustable thresholds for voltage/current, recovery times, and calibration (P-1 to P-17). Password protection (P-17) to prevent unauthorized changes. 2. Technical Specifications Category Details Power Supply AC: 320V / DC: 80–300V Frequency 50/60Hz (AC only) Voltage Range AC: 80–300V (setting), 80–210V (operating) / DC: 130–300V (setting), 80–210V (operating) Max Current 40A/63A (configurable) Accuracy Voltage: <1% Response Time Overvoltage: 0.5s (no delay) / Adjustable trip delays (P-7, P-10) Environmental -25°C to +50°C, ≤2000m altitude, ≤50% humidity (at 40°C) Physical 512 × 960mm, 15kg
3. Setup & Operation Guide A. Initial Configuration
Power Connection :Wire terminals (N-L) to AC/DC source within rated limits. Menu Navigation :Use front-panel buttons to adjust parameters (P-1 to P-17). B. Critical Settings
Parameter Purpose Default Range P-3/P-5 Over/under-voltage thresholds 300V/80V AC: 80–300V / DC: 130–300V P-9 Max current limit 63A 14–63A P-15 Auto-recovery after fault ON ON/OFF P-17 Password lock 000 000–999
C. Calibration
Voltage: Adjust via P-8 (±10%). Current: Calibrate with P-12 (±10%). Frequency (AC only): Fine-tune with P-13 (±2.5%). D. Safety & Recovery
Manual Reset: Required if auto-recovery (P-15) is disabled. Event Logging: Overcurrent counts (P-11) track fault history. 4. Usage Notes DC Mode: Current display disabled; only voltage monitored. Energy Saving: Enable P-16 to reduce idle power consumption. Altitude Warning: Performance may degrade above 2000m.
